There should be no meddling with constitutional status of J-K: Mehbooba Mufti

SRINAGAR: PDP president Mehbooba Mufti on Friday said there should be no meddling with the constitutional status of Jammu and Kashmir till a popular Government takes power.

Mehbooba said there seemed to be a “hidden agenda” behind the decisions to treat Jammu and Kashmir Bank as a PSU, changing procedures of state subject rules, revoking Roshni scheme and reports of changing Juvenile (Justice) Act.

“We respect the Governor (S P Malik), (but) why is he encroaching upon the democratic space? There is no emergency on these issues. They can happen after elections when a new Government is formed. It seems that there is perhaps someone’s hidden agenda, which I hope the Governor will not be a part of… There should be no fiddling with the constitutional status of the State,” Mehbooba told reporters here.
